1995年日本发生震级为7.3级的阪神大地震,伤亡惨重,建筑和公路毁于一旦,引发了日本对钢铁材料重要性的思考。为了适应未来发展,很多学者提出要开发更坚固的钢铁材料。这是研发“超级钢铁”的起源。
